[QUOTE="Broz, post: 719724, member: 7503"] I doubt the accuracy difference will be noticeable to the average long range shooter/ hunter. But the velocity using the larger bullet offerings might. My first group at 1007 yards with my 300 win using the new 215 Berger hybrid was under 4". The first 100 yard group with them during load work up was a 3 shots into one ragged hole. I have since taken antelope at 805, 1005 and another at 1285 yards all one shot kills. Also busted a rock cold bore one shot at 1465 yards. I may be a little biased but for me to believe the 300 win gives up any long range accuracy I will have to go out and we will shoot together. Jeff [/QUOTE]
